The Incident and Its Aftermath

The incident in question occurred during a post-game press conference, where O'Brien was questioned about the team's performance. The reporter's line of questioning was perceived as overly aggressive, leading O'Brien to snap back and accuse them of being too harsh. The exchange was caught on camera, and it has since gone viral on social media. The reaction from the sports community has been mixed, with some defending O'Brien's right to defend his team and others criticizing his behavior as unprofessional.
